Effects of alcohol : All characters can have two drinks without beeing affected. As soon as your character has a third drink, however, you must make a Backbone Check. If the Check succeeds, the drink does'nt affect your character. If the Check fails, your character is drunk. Cut all of a drunk character's Attributes Ratings to 1/2.
Continue to make Backbone Checks for each drink a character takes after the third. If he is drunk, your Backbone Rating is cut to 1/2 when you makes these Checks. If your character fails a Backbone Check when he's drunk, cut all of his Attributes Ratings to 1/4. He is now very drunk. If he continues to drink, you must make a Backbone Check for each drink he takes. If he is very drunk, your character falls inconscious once he fails a Backbone Check.

1934
ARMY SUPPRESSES UPRISING IN SPAIN.
RIOTING BREAKS OUT IN MOROCCO.
CHACO WAR CONTINUES.
The Soviet Union joins the League of Nations.
General strike is called in San Francisco.
U.S. troops withdraw from Haiti.
King Alexander of Yugoslavia is assassinated in France.
Adolf Hitler purges the Brownshirts in the "Night of the Long Knifes".
Chinese Communists begin the Long March to escape Nationalist forces.
Attributes modifiers
A lot of things can affect your character in an adventure, so you will often have to change your character's Attribute Ratings, based on specific situations. These changes are called modifiers. Some situations that can modify your character's Attribute Ratings are listed on the Referee's Screen.
All modifiers affect your character's Attributes the same way. They may :
- Double the Attribute Ratings (X2)
- Cut the Attribute Ratings to one-half of their original numbers (1/2)
- Cut the Attribute Ratings to one-quarter of their original numbers (1/4)
